We all know there are some smells our leos don't like - a perfume, hand soap, food, etc. that they'll have nothing to do with if it's too strong on you. For mine it's lotion and oranges.

I seem to have found something my leo really likes, though. :main_laugh: I was making little chocolate lava cakes - you know, the souffle-things with the goo in the middle.
I hadn't washed the batter off my hands too thoroughly as I was still in the middle of baking them, just a rinse with cold water to get the stain-y bits off before I got close to the carpet, but the gecko was out on top of his hide and staring at me so I put put a hand down into his cage to see if he wanted out.

Normally he'll put his face close to my hand, give it a lick or two to see what I am, and then either climb up or turn away from me.

This time he shoved his little nose against my fingers and just slid up and down them looking really, really interested and licking at them. It felt more like he was tasting my hand than just "sniffing" it, and he had that look on his face like when he's trying to decide whether an unfamiliar prey item is worth grabbing at or not - I decided I'd better leave him be until I'd washed my hands. :laugh:

I doubt it was actually the chocolate, but maybe the butter? Most animals like butter.
Have you found any scents your leo thinks make you look tasty?
